Всем привет вот решил попытать свои силы в JavaScript и вот даю на публику свою первую работу:
По некоторым просьбам я решил сделать[b] NoSpam.Counter[/b]
NoSpam.Counter - Счетчик который не даёт добавить ответ до тех пор, пока в сообщении не будет определенного количества символов. В моём случае это 25 символов.
[b]Для чего нужен данный скрипт? [/b] Данный скрипт писался с целью защиты от таких сообщений: "Ох...спс" "Кульно,спс" "Автору зачет" и т.д.
Установка:
В <head></head> добавляем данную строку:
[code]<script src="http://code.jquery.com/jquery.min.js" type="text/javascript"></script>[/code]
Заходим в "Управление Дизайном" -> Форум -> Форма добавления сообщений:
После:
[code]<tr id="frM56"><td width="25%" class="gTableLeft" id="frM57" valign="top">Текст сообщения:<div class="smilesPart">$SMILES$</div></td><td class="gTableRight" id="frM58">$BBCODES$ $_MESSAGE$ [/code]
Добавляем:
[code]<script type="text/javascript">
$("#frF16").attr("disabled", "disabled");
$("#message").keypress(function () {
$("#frF16").attr("disabled", this.value.length < 25);
});
</script>[/code]
Количество ограниченных символом можно изменить: this.value.length < [b]25[/b] Идея — [url=http://dididima.info]dididima[/url]
Реализация — [url=http://dididima.info]dididima[/url] & exec.